Foresight Aero FC RX-7 Type 1
There’s something about the FC3S RX-7 that never fades. Sleek, low-slung, and effortlessly cool, it’s a shape that’s aged like a perfectly worn leather jacket—still rebellious, still iconic. And with the Foresight aero kit, that timeless silhouette steps into something even more distinct.
Foresight’s take on the FC doesn’t shout—it doesn’t need to. The design is confident, refined, and perfectly era-correct. The front bumper flows with a sharp horizontal line that sits wide and low, extending the car’s presence without overdoing it. Paired with subtle yet aggressive side skirts and a clean rear bumper, it’s a full look that completes the FC instead of competing with it.
But the real magic is in the details. The way the lip gently juts forward like a nod to vintage Group 5 styling. The squared-off profile of the side skirts that give the chassis a grounded, planted stance. Even the way the rear end wraps around the taillights—simple, but striking.
